Ну ваша работает неправильно.
все правильно работает в 2013-м экселе.
параметры форматирования:
1)=СЧИТАТЬПУСТОТЫ($A1:$B1)>1
2)=ДНИ(СЕГОДНЯ();$A1)*СЧИТАТЬПУСТОТЫ($B1)>5
3)=ЕПУСТО($B1)
4)=ДНИ($B1;$A1)*СЧЁТЗ($B1)<6
5)=ДНИ($B1;$A1)*СЧЁТЗ($B1)>5
Копипаст кривой, но думаю, смысл понятен (при попытке сохранить в xls):
Существенная потеря функциональности Число экземпляров Версия
Число условных форматов в некоторых ячейках превышает поддерживаемое выбранным форматом файла. В более ранних версиях Excel будут отображаться только первые три условия. 1
Лист1'!B1:B100 Excel 97–2003
Некоторые ячейки содержат условное форматирование со снятым параметром "Остановить, если истина". Более ранним версиям Excel этот параметр не известен, поэтому выполнение будет остановлено после первого истинного условия. 5
Лист1'!B1:B100 Excel 97–2003
Книга содержит одну или несколько функций, которые отсутствуют в текущей версии Excel. После пересчета эти функции вернут не правильный результат, а значение #ИМЯ?. 3
Лист1'!B1:B100 Excel 97–2003
Excel 2007
Excel 2010